Originally Posted by mlyngard
Shoe fits vary like crazy. Difference between a 7 and 8 is about 1/2". Yes, I think you'll fit. I just got a few pair from Zappos and returned all of them and went a size smaller than I'm used to. I got 9s, and I've never gone below 10 before. The 9s fit great (and these were structured leather shoes, not stretchy canvas sneakers).

Dude you weren't kidding... i received the 7s today and they're both only a half size smaller for a full size down, wtf? These things are narrow as hell too! The PF Flyers are roomier but i like the looks of the chucks better. Maybe they'll stretch out a bit after a bit of wear... i hope.

***ok now actually wearing a pair for a little bit tonight that feel right size wise... they hurt my feet a bit. People werent kidding when they said there is NO support. The PF Flyers have more than this and i didnt think it would be noticable difference, but it is. Now i'm wondering if i should keep these in a size 7 or go back to the 8s and put some sort of inserts in them? What do most of you do as far as that goes?
